In article <1292@red8.qtp.ufl.edu> bernhold@qtp.ufl.edu (David E. Bernholdt) writes:

   Does anyone know of an electronic mailing list or other forum for
   ToolPack users?


Yes, there is: for now the list is accessible via toolpack@lanl.gov.
If there is sufficient interest I will revive it (i.e. be in a
position to *add* people to the list) as toolpack@bchs.uh.edu. 

The toolpack releases continue to be available via anonymous FTP from
menudo.uh.edu, 129.7.1.6, in ~ftp/pub/toopack.
